2010 Chevrolet Concept Camaro Features

Heaven Just Couldn't Handle All the Noise

2009 Chevrolet Camaro Concept Car Revealed from Gandrud Chevrolet in Green Bay, Wisconsin
Concept vehicle shown. Camaro Coupe will be available first quarter 2010 Camaro Convertible will follow within a year of the coupe.

Performance Feature Highlights

400-hp, 6.0 Liter LS2 V8 engine

Choice of automatic or manual transmission with widely spaced
ratios for aggressive acceleration

Rear-wheel drive with fully independent suspension

Lightweight 21-inch front, 22-inch rear aluminum wheels

Billet aluminum shifter and pedals

There was a time when performance was measured in decibels. Forty years of research and development has brought engineering improvements to all aspects of Camaro performance — not just in how it looks, but in how it drives and sounds. Today, Concept Camaro is just as outspoken as ever.

On the inside, the four-pack auxiliary gauge concept is a dramatic tribute to the classic. The oil, battery, fuel and temperature gauges are squared and placed on the center console. The rest is a sign of the times. The instrument panel is kept clean — as steadfast performance focus — with a white-faced tachometer and speedometer deeply set within smoked satin metallic bezels. The correlation between past and emerging technology comes to life by using analog gauges for certain readouts and digital for others. For instance, there's a digital indicator on the tachometer to show what gear you're in and one in the center of the speedometer that shows when the highbeam headlamps are lit.

Black and platinum-toned seats are fitted with firm side bolsters and Alcantara® inserts. They were designed to be noticed — right down to the Hugger Orange accent stitching in the Convertible.

And now, Camaro is returning to the streets. You'll be able to get the four-passenger, rear-wheel-drive performance Camaro Coupe in first quarter 2010 and the Camaro Convertible will follow within a year of the coupe.
